Nexus
Introduction
Nexus is a repository manager that can store and manage components, build artifacts, and release candidates in one central location. At stakater, we use nexus to store docker images of our prod application like stakaterfrontend and emailservice etc.
Chart
We use public helm charts to deploy nexus on our cluster. Here is the public chart that we use and 1.12.1
is the public chart version that is used in our cluster. We use umbrella charts to deploy nexus on our cluster. Currently we are using this repository for nexus deployment.

Installation
Installation Steps
- Nexus can be deployed using pipeline of this repository. We can also deploy this manually (not recommended) via console. To deploy it manually
- Download the chart
helm repo add stable https://kubernetes-charts.storage.googleapis.com helm repo update helm fetch stable/sonatype-nexus --version 1.12.1
- Unzip the chart and go the the unzipped chart directory.
- Update the values.yaml file. See the hard coded values here
- Run below command
helm install --name <release name> . --namespace <namespace name>

Nexus configmap contains the postStart configuration script.
sonatype-nexus:
config:
enabled: true
mountPath: /sonatype-nexus-conf
data:
postStart.sh: |
#!/usr/bin/env bash
HOST=localhost:8081
# default user setup by Nexus. In the end of this script I will remove all roles from this account
USERNAME=admin
PASSWORD=admin123
apk add --no-cache curl
# Admin Account details specified in nexus secret .admin_account.json
ADMIN_ACCOUNT_USERNAME=stackator-admin
# Cluster Account details specified in nexus secret .cluster_account.json
CLUSTER_ACCOUNT_USERNAME=stackator-cluster
echo `pwd`
cd /sonatype-nexus-conf/
REPOS=($(ls | grep json | sed -e 's/\..*$//'))
until $(curl --output /dev/null --silent --head --fail http://$HOST/); do
echo $?
printf '.'
sleep 5
done
if [ ${#REPOS[@]} -lt 1 ]
then
echo "Not enough JSON files!"
exit 1
fi
echo "uploading secret admin account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: application/json"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/" -d @/etc/secret-volume/.admin_account.json)
if [ $STATUSCODE -eq 403 ]
then
echo "Already initialized; as we remove rights of the admin user in the end of this script; when it runs first time. So, when container restarts it should work."
exit 0
elif [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not upload secret"
exit 1
else
echo $STATUSCODE
fi
echo "Executing secret admin account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-X POST -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: text/plain"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/${ADMIN_ACCOUNT_USERNAME}/run")
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not execute secret"
exit 1
fi
echo "Delete secret admin account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l -X "DELETE" --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/${ADMIN_ACCOUNT_USERNAME}")
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not delete secret"
exit 1
fi
echo "Uploading secret cluster account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: application/json"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/" -d @/etc/secret-volume/.cluster_account.json)
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not upload secret"
exit 1
fi
echo "Executing secret cluster account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-X POST -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: text/plain"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/${CLUSTER_ACCOUNT_USERNAME}/run")
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not execute secret"
exit 1
fi
echo "Deleting secret cluster account script"
STATUSCODE=$(curl -X "DELETE" --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/${CLUSTER_ACCOUNT_USERNAME}")
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not delete secret"
exit 1
fi
for i in "${REPOS[@]}"
do
echo "creating $i repository"
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: application/json"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/" -d @$i.json)
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not upload $i"
exit 1
fi
STATUSCODE=$(curl --output /dev/stderr --silent -v -X POST -u $USERNAME:$PASSWORD --header "Content-Type: text/plain" --write-out "%{http_code}" "http://$HOST/service/rest/v1/script/$i/run")
if [ $STATUSCODE -lt 200 ] || [ $STATUSCODE -gt 299 ]
then
echo "Could not execute $i"
exit 1
fi
done
exit $?
